40 int
41 SendNeedFragIcmp(int sock, struct ip *failedDgram, int mtu)
42 {
43 	char			icmpBuf[IP_MAXPACKET];
44 	struct ip*		ip;
45 	struct icmp*		icmp;
46 	int			icmpLen;
47 	int			failBytes;
48 	int			failHdrLen;
49 	struct sockaddr_in	addr;
50 	int			wrote;
51 	struct in_addr		swap;
52 /*
53  * Don't send error if packet is
54  * not the first fragment.
55  */
56 	if (ntohs(failedDgram->ip_off) & ~(IP_MF | IP_DF))
57 		return 0;
58 /*
59  * Dont respond if failed datagram is ICMP.
60  */
61 	if (failedDgram->ip_p == IPPROTO_ICMP)
62 		return 0;
63 /*
64  * Start building the message.
65  */
66 	ip   = (struct ip *)icmpBuf;
67 	icmp = (struct icmp *)(icmpBuf + sizeof(struct ip));
68 /*
69  * Complete ICMP part.
70  */
71 	icmp->icmp_type		= ICMP_UNREACH;
72 	icmp->icmp_code		= ICMP_UNREACH_NEEDFRAG;
73 	icmp->icmp_cksum	= 0;
74 	icmp->icmp_void		= 0;
75 	icmp->icmp_nextmtu	= htons(mtu);
76 /*
77  * Copy header + 64 bits of original datagram.
78  */
79 	failHdrLen = (failedDgram->ip_hl << 2);
80 	failBytes  = failedDgram->ip_len - failHdrLen;
81 	if (failBytes > 8)
82 		failBytes = 8;
83 
84 	failBytes += failHdrLen;
85 	icmpLen	   = ICMP_MINLEN + failBytes;
86 
87 	memcpy(&icmp->icmp_ip, failedDgram, failBytes);
88 /*
89  * Calculate checksum.
90  */
91 	icmp->icmp_cksum = PacketAliasInternetChecksum((u_short *)icmp,
92 						       icmpLen);
93 /*
94  * Add IP header using old IP header as template.
95  */
96 	memcpy(ip, failedDgram, sizeof(struct ip));
97 
98 	ip->ip_v	= 4;
99 	ip->ip_hl	= 5;
100 	ip->ip_len	= htons(sizeof(struct ip) + icmpLen);
101 	ip->ip_p	= IPPROTO_ICMP;
102 	ip->ip_tos	= 0;
103 
104 	swap = ip->ip_dst;
105 	ip->ip_dst = ip->ip_src;
106 	ip->ip_src = swap;
107 
108 	PacketAliasIn((char *)ip, IP_MAXPACKET);
109 
110 	addr.sin_family		= AF_INET;
111 	addr.sin_addr		= ip->ip_dst;
112 	addr.sin_port		= 0;
113 /*
114  * Put packet into processing queue.
115  */
116 	wrote = sendto(sock,
117 		       icmp,
118 		       icmpLen,
119 		       0,
120 		       (struct sockaddr *)&addr,
121 	    	       sizeof addr);
122 
123 	if (wrote != icmpLen)
124 		Warn("Cannot send ICMP message.");
125 
126 	return 1;
127 }
